Output d694892060a15f01a5c3612039f420205e7bd925678df435e93f62298ad20586:24

value
12965669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ef4e487e72f0a76c79ffc03a7c67b954feabf34 OP_EQUAL
address
MF6eJqST6ybXEcTcUBgmJJ4U697yf5srDk
transaction
d694892060a15f01a5c3612039f420205e7bd925678df435e93f62298ad20586
spent
true